Understanding the performance of webassembly applications

Y Yan, T Tu, L Zhao, Y Zhou, W Wang - Proceedings of the 21st ACM …, 2021 - dl.acm.org
WebAssembly is the newest language to arrive on the web. It features a compact binary
format, making it fast to be loaded and decoded. While WebAssembly is generally expected …

A survey on load testing of large-scale software systems

ZM Jiang, AE Hassan - IEEE Transactions on Software …, 2015 - ieeexplore.ieee.org
Many large-scale software systems must service thousands or millions of concurrent
requests. These systems must be load tested to ensure that they can function correctly under …

The Palladio component model for model-driven performance prediction

S Becker, H Koziolek, R Reussner - Journal of Systems and Software, 2009 - Elsevier
One aim of component-based software engineering (CBSE) is to enable the prediction of
extra-functional properties, such as performance and reliability, utilising a well-defined …

Performance evaluation of component-based software systems: A survey

H Koziolek - Performance evaluation, 2010 - Elsevier
Performance prediction and measurement approaches for component-based software
systems help software architects to evaluate their systems based on component …

A pragmatic evaluation of stress and performance testing technologies for web based applications

S Pradeep, YK Sharma - 2019 Amity International Conference …, 2019 - ieeexplore.ieee.org
The cumulative and multi-dimensional audit of the software applications are required so that
the evaluation of the software suite on assorted tasks can be evaluated. In this manuscript …

Performance regression testing target prioritization via performance risk analysis

P Huang, X Ma, D Shen, Y Zhou - Proceedings of the 36th International …, 2014 - dl.acm.org
As software evolves, problematic changes can significantly degrade software performance,
ie, introducing performance regression. Performance regression testing is an effective way …

Automated extraction of architecture-level performance models of distributed component-based systems

F Brosig, N Huber, S Kounev - 2011 26th IEEE/ACM …, 2011 - ieeexplore.ieee.org
Modern enterprise applications have to satisfy increasingly stringent Quality-of-Service
requirements. To ensure that a system meets its performance requirements, the ability to …

Perfranker: Prioritization of performance regression tests for collection-intensive software

S Mostafa, X Wang, T **e - Proceedings of the 26th ACM SIGSOFT …, 2017 - dl.acm.org
Regression performance testing is an important but time/resource-consuming phase during
software development. Developers need to detect performance regressions as early as …

Autoconfig: Automatic configuration tuning for distributed message systems

L Bao, X Liu, Z Xu, B Fang - Proceedings of the 33rd ACM/IEEE …, 2018 - dl.acm.org
Distributed message systems (DMSs) serve as the communication backbone for many real-
time streaming data processing applications. To support the vast diversity of such …

Performance prediction of component-based systems: A survey from an engineering perspective

S Becker, L Grunske, R Mirandola… - Architecting Systems with …, 2006 - Springer
Performance predictions of component assemblies and the ability of obtaining system-level
performance properties from these predictions are a crucial success factor when building …